About the role
KPMG is seeking a Manager in Customer & Operations for our Consulting practice. This role focuses on leading key work streams and project delivery activities in Sales Transformation solutions, assisting highly skilled client and KPMG work teams, and contributing to thought leadership and business development.
Responsibilities
- Lead key work streams and project delivery activities in Sales Transformation solutions.
- Execute transformational projects including diagnostics/business cases, channel strategy and alignment, sales strategy, sales model and go-to-market (GTM) design, sales through service process optimization, sales force skill building and development, sales performance measurement & rewards, sales tool and enablement (CRM/SPM), sales culture, and sales data and analytics.
- Assist client and KPMG work teams throughout the project lifecycle, leveraging approaches in Sales Effectiveness and Transformation across B2B, B2B2C, and B2C models in industries such as Financial Services, Healthcare and Life Sciences, Technology, Media, Telecommunications, and Industrial Manufacturing.
- Participate in the development and publication of thought leadership and service offerings across customer advisory businesses, including marketing, sales transformation, CX, and customer analytics capabilities.
- Support proposal development and business development activities by leveraging relationships with C-level executives.
- Assist in recruiting and training top sales effectiveness talent.
Requirements
- A minimum of five years of relevant top-tier management consulting experience (including Big Four experience) related to sales force effectiveness, sales effectiveness, SPM, and CRM across diverse industries.
- Bachelor’s degree in a related field from a leading accredited college/university; MBA preferred.
- Experience with large transformations involving front office technology such as Vericent, Microsoft CRM, Salesforce.com, Anaplan, and Callidus Cloud.
- Experience with Customer Buying Patterns, Channel Strategy/Alignment, Sales Model Design Strategy, Sales Force Talent/Skill Building, Sales Performance Management/Incentives, Sales Tools Enablement, Building High Performing Sales Cultures, and Sales Analytics/Insights.
- Demonstrated ability to analyze and diagnose the strategy, people, process, and technology root causes for client sales performance issues.
- Travel may be up to 80-100%.
- Must be authorized to work in the U.S. without the need for employment-based visa sponsorship now or in the future.
